## Driver assignment heuristic — review notes

The Fleetwise dispatcher scores drivers on proximity, shift remaining, and recent decline rate, then assigns the top candidate unless the fairness cap triggers. Reviewers should confirm the cap is evaluated before the proximity tiebreak, not after — inverting the order caused clustering in the Harwick pilot. Weights live in the heuristic config, not code. Changes require a replay run against last week's dispatch log. The replayed build token appears below.

trace token, fafof-tajef: htk9_849b0fd88

### PR: Introduce strict semver gating for Lattice UI components

This change enforces semantic-version contracts across the Lattice shared component library. Breaking prop changes now require a major bump, verified by a snapshot diff of each component's public API. Future maintainers: the gating thresholds are deliberately conservative because downstream teams at Harwick pin minor ranges. Loosening them needs sign-off from the platform guild. All thresholds live in one config module; the current values appear below.

tuning constants:
RATE_LIMITS = {
    "wenwyn": 1,
    "zorix": 10,
    "oliix": 2,
    "holael": 10,
}

Q: What do I need to know about the landlord's site audit?
A: Hartleaf Estates will audit Building C on the 14th. Assistants must ensure corridors are clear and fire doors unpropped by 08:30. Auditors will be escorted by the facilities lead; do not let them roam alone. They may ask to see the plant room on Level 4, which is normally locked. If asked, open it using the code below.

staff pass of kawip-hawef = bdg-QLP-2

TURN-208: Gatevale turnstile counters at the Merrow Field pilot double-count when a rotation reverses mid-cycle. Attendance totals drift roughly 2% high per event. The debounce window fix is implemented, reviewed by Ilsa, and soak-tested across two simulated match days without drift. Ready for your cut; the candidate build is identified below.

trace token, tagag-tafog: htk6_5ed18c